Black Bat vs Buffy Broad-nosed Bat
Lasionycteris noctivagans compared with Platyrrhinus infuscus
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Black Bat | Buffy Broad-nosed Bat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order same | Chiroptera (Bats)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Vespertilionidae | Phyllostomidae |
| Genus | Lasionycteris | Platyrrhinus |
| Species | Lasionycteris noctivagans | Platyrrhinus infuscus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Black Bat and Buffy Broad-nosed Bat share a common ancestor at the Order level: Chiroptera. (Bats)
